About a dozen members of the Piri Piri-Glengarry Women’s Institute assembled on the railway platform on Wednesday afternoon to greet Miss E. Bartholomew, an English visitor to the Dominion, who was passing through Dannevirke en route to Napier. Miss Bartholomew is a member of the Women’s Institute at Capel, Surrey. This institute i 3 the Piri Piri-Glengarry Institute’s English link, and the two organisations correspond regularly, thereby giving and gaining useful information. Miss Bartholomew proved to be an interesting personality and the members greatly enjoyed meeting someone whom they had known only as a correspondent.
